JEAN RUSSAK

Jean teaches piano to students of all ages and abilities. She also coaches vocal and chamber music repertoire and is currently accepting new students.

Jean has played many roles in the world of music --piano teacher, vocal and chamber music coach, concert pianist, and musical director of operas and musical comedies. Jean earned a Bachelor of Music degree from Oberlin and a Master of Music degree from the University of Illinois . Her teachers include Harold Bauer, Soulima Stravinsky, Nadia Reisenberg and David Leighton. Among her many accomplishments, Jean provided music direction for the NY production of “The Fantasticks,” and played for the Amato Opera Theatre for many years.

Her resume also includes many projects and classes with her husband, Gerard.
